Chapter 55
* * *
This meeting was decided to be held by directly visiting a certain orphanage in the outskirts of the capital.
It was to check the current situation of the orphanage and see if there were any inconvenient aspects of the facilities.
Of course, detailed investigations were being conducted continuously by dispatching people.
Still, the Crown Prince’s direct visit to the orphanage itself was a declaration of intent that he was taking this issue seriously.
Thus, on the day of the meeting.
Joshua was fidgeting with the cravat around his neck inside the carriage.
It was the cravat that Elodie had given him as a gift, which she had ‘made herself’.
‘……There was no need to specifically choose this cravat.’
But it kept catching his eye.
In the end, he couldn’t resist and picked up this cravat.
What was the identity of this feeling?
Something that kept making him restless……
“Phew.”
Just as Joshua let out a short sigh.
“Your Highness, we have arrived.”
“I understand.”
Joshua nodded and lightly rose to his feet.
And so, as he was about to enter the orphanage with other attendants.
‘Hmm?’
His purple eyes widened slightly for a moment.
In the distance, an elderly man was flustered and bustling about, not knowing what to do.
He seemed to be one of the orphanage directors scheduled to meet today.
Apparently having come up from the provinces, he was holding a large travel bag in his hand.
“Do you happen to have a spare cravat?”
“Really, who comes to meet His Highness the Crown Prince without a cravat?”
Another orphanage director scolded him in a lowered voice.
“What if I go buy one right now……”
“There’s no time!”
Joshua quietly observed the man who was clearly troubled.
His clothing was well-maintained but showed signs of age.
It was obvious he had tried his best to dress neatly in his own way.
He had dressed up intending to be respectful, but it seemed he hadn’t thought as far as the cravat.
Well, that was understandable.
He probably had never worn formal attire in his life.
Moreover, cravats were items mainly worn by nobles.
This meant commoners rarely had occasion to use them.
‘Just coming up to the capital must have required great resolve.’
In the midst of that, forgetting a small accessory like a cravat was perfectly understandable.
But then.
“……”
“……”
An icy silence fell.
The orphanage directors who had been whispering were now looking in this direction.
They turned pale and hurriedly bowed.
“W-welcome, Your Highness.”
“It is an honor to meet you like this.”
Among them, the orphanage director who had forgotten his cravat looked pitifully pale.
Joshua, who had been quietly watching him, suddenly untied the cravat around his neck.
‘Huh?’
The orphanage director’s eyes widened slightly for a moment.
“Your Highness?”
The attendants also became wide-eyed like surprised rabbits and stared at Joshua.
Joshua commanded his attendants with a smiling face.
“Everyone, untie your cravats.”
After being bewildered for a moment.
Seeing the flustered orphanage director, the attendants soon understood why their lord had given such a command.
The attendants also untied their cravats in unison.
Confirming this, Joshua opened his mouth calmly as if nothing had happened.
“Well then, let’s all go inside.”
* * *
Since this meeting was held, the fashion industry suddenly began paying attention to His Highness the Crown Prince.
No, let me correct that.
Actually, they had been interested from the beginning.
Since he was such a handsome and capable Crown Prince, he was already receiving all the attention from the Ladies.
The fashion industry, which quickly grasped the Ladies’ demands, had long been keeping a close eye on His Highness’s clothing and worn items……
Well, anyway!
The story goes like this.
A certain newspaper published an editorial related to this meeting.
That editorial contained two detailed drawings of the Crown Prince.
One showed the Crown Prince leading his attendants into the orphanage.
The other showed him leaving after finishing the meeting.
<When His Highness the Crown Prince first entered the orphanage, both His Highness and all his attendants were clearly wearing cravats.
However, when they came out after finishing the meeting, the cravats were nowhere to be seen.
Why was that?
As a result of our investigation, this was to show consideration for Mr. Gustav, one of the orphanage directors.
Mr. Gustav had been busy coming up from a distant province and had forgotten to bring a cravat.
His Highness the Crown Prince, showing consideration for Mr. Gustav, attended the meeting with everyone not wearing cravats.
Mr. Gustav was moved by His Highness the Crown Prince’s thoughtfulness…….>
Well, up to this point, it was just a common heartwarming story you could see anywhere.
It only became a topic because the subject of that heartwarming story was His Highness the Crown Prince, who enjoyed empire-wide popularity.
However, the artist had drawn His Highness the Crown Prince’s outfit extremely meticulously.
‘Huh?’
I, who was reading the newspaper, was startled.
‘This cravat, I made this!’
Well, it didn’t feel bad.
It meant he had treated my cravat preciously.
Moreover, it wasn’t even a bad thing, and it came up in connection with good deeds.
‘As expected, he has the style of a wise ruler, right?’
I thought that would be it – just some casual talk about His Highness’s virtuous character and then it would end…….
‘But that wasn’t the case.’
Suddenly, fashion magazines started pouring out articles about His Highness’s attire!
Since I’m planning to run a dress shop in the future.
I need to keep up with trends, so I’ve been subscribing to most fashion magazines.
But those magazines all started running special features about the Crown Prince at once.
Just looking at this magazine I’m holding right now…….
Below the huge headline,
<After much effort, we were able to make an inquiry to the Crown Prince's palace.
The Crown Prince’s palace sent back a reply saying, “There’s a dress shop he usually patronizes, and they made it for him.”
Our magazine also asked which dress shop it was, but the Crown Prince’s palace politely declined, saying they couldn’t reveal the dress shop…….>
An article with this content was published.
That’s right.
Unintentionally, they ended up responding with secrecy…….
Well, from the Crown Prince’s perspective, it would be natural.
I hadn’t even told him the name of the dress shop.
However, people’s curiosity exploded at the Crown Prince’s palace’s response.
“About the cravat His Highness the Crown Prince wore this time. Where on earth could it be from?”
“Exactly! Did you see it too, madam?”
“Of course. Isn’t this the first time His Highness the Crown Prince has directly mentioned a dress shop?”
And so, currently.
I, who was about to take a sip of black tea at a certain tea house, quietly put down my teacup.
I was afraid I might choke if I wasn’t careful.
The whole world was talking about His Highness the Crown Prince’s cravat…….
“Which dress shop could it be?”
“Just how amazing must it be for them to keep it secret?”
“Come to think of it, that cravat did look incredibly luxurious and pretty.”
No.
It only looked good because the Crown Prince was wearing it.
That cravat was something I made myself!
Though it looked decent enough thanks to Isabel’s help, it’s not such an amazing piece that it should be worn to such an important occasion.
‘Why did His Highness the Crown Prince wear that cravat in the first place?’
I tilted my head inwardly for only a moment.
I perked up my ears and focused on the conversations blooming among the noble ladies and ladies in small groups.
“Anyway, I hope that dress shop is revealed soon.”
“Me too. If they can make even one cravat so well, I’m excited to see how pretty their other garments must be.”
“When the dress shop’s name comes out, I want to go take a look too.”
“They don’t only do men’s clothing, right? I actually need a dress myself…….”
I subtly hid my rising smile by lifting my teacup.
Crown Prince marketing is the best!
